概括
骨的原发性血管肉瘤很少见,通常会影响长骨. 这一案例突显了它在腰椎中罕见的发生,在PET/CT扫描上呈现为骨解质破坏与高FDG吸收.

背景情况:
- 原发性骨血管瘤是一种罕见的恶性血管瘤.
- 它最常影响长骨,骨盆和干部.
- 腰部脚和横向过程的参与非常罕见.

Positron Emission Tomography
4.3K
Positron emission tomography (PET) is a medical imaging technique involving radiopharmaceuticals — substances that emit short-lived radiation. Although the first PET scanner was introduced in 1961, it took 15 more years before radiopharmaceuticals were combined with the technique and revolutionized its potential.
One of the main requirements of a PET scan is a positron-emitting radioisotope, which is produced in a cyclotron and then attached to a substance used by the part of the body...
